India's macroeconomic fundamentals continue to provide a strong foundation for the long-term
growth. Even amid a volatile global environment, the Indian economy remains amongst the
fastest-growing major economies. The GDP is projected to expand around 6.6% in FY26-27,
supported by strong momentum in private consumption and services.
Alongside stable economic state, India's rapid digital transformation is reshaping how
consumers and business transact, creating a stronger foundation for digital financial services.
India's digital payment ecosystem continues to expand rapidly, supported by strong merchant
payments growth and an extensive QR network infrastructure.
India has emerged as a global leader in real-time digital payments, with 49% of the worldwide
transaction volume and UPI serving as the backbone of the country's digital economy, enabling
instant and secure payments on scale. The future of financial services lies in the convergence of
payments and credit.
The UPI drives engagement and credit cards deepen customer relationships through credit
access, flexibility, rewards and trust. A significant development has been the growing adoption
of RuPay credit cards on UPI, which is expanding the role of credit cards. This structural
evolution is translating into sustained growth for the credit card industry.
India now has 121 million credit cards in circulation. Looking ahead, the industry is projected
to grow consistently over the next decade. The regulatory environment has also evolved
significantly, with increased emphasis on responsible lending, customer suitability, digital
resilience, cybersecurity and customer protection.

As regards to business performance, building on the momentum from the second half of FY26,
we began the financial year FY27 by delivering on our stated objective across business and
financial metrics.
I'm pleased to share that as of now, SBI Cards is the second largest credit card player in terms
of cards in force, spends as well as transactions. Cards in force have grown to around INR2.26
crores, witnessing a 7% growth Y-o-Y.
In alignment with our stated strategy and road map, we successfully added more than 1 million
new accounts in Q1 FY27, with 17% Y-o-Y growth. As per the RBI data released yesterday,
SBI Card has made a net card addition of INR4.84 lakhs, which is highest in the industry for the
quarter. Our sourcing distribution remains balanced, with about 47% sourcing from Banca and
53% from the open market.
As per RBI June 2026 data, our spend market share has grown to 19.5% versus 18.1% in FY26.
Total spends have reached highest ever level of INR1,18,475 crores in Q1 of FY27, growing
27% Y-o-Y. Retail spend also reached INR94,033 crores with a 14% Y-o-Y growth. We have
seen good growth in both POS and online spend across most spend categories. Key ones include
consumer durables, furnishing and hardware, apparel and jewellery.
